Output 1b95efa61281db28bf7ccc685c262200678c183e84da6f0c0376289861b71747:29

value
23460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8834be157240c906d82c09c27fe404a6a0495c50 OP_EQUAL
address
3E7D1FGh56Mkg7apmqVY9scHfJ7TtHxNHy
transaction
1b95efa61281db28bf7ccc685c262200678c183e84da6f0c0376289861b71747
spent
true